  • Classics: Drehobl's Chicken Cow

    Classics: Drehobl's Chicken Cow
    It's hard to find a Thrasher video that Dan Drehobl didn't at least have a few clips in, but out of them all, I'm gonna have to go with his part in Hall Of Meat as my favorite. This 1999 part introduced the late Wesley Willis to me, and with tricks like wrap-arounds and dumptrucks to fakie in the Vagabond? You pick a better nomination for a Classic. —Schmitty
